For those of us who might be able to make our own fish extenders before we go....what are the dimensions of the pockets in Deb's? And are they the perfect size or would they be better a little bigger or a little smaller??

:tigger:

Erik
 
OK, mine is a five pocket one. It is 27 inches from top of dowel pocket to bottom of lowest pocket. The pockets are 8" by 5 1/2 ". The pockets have a 1" pleat on each side to make room for goodies. there is an 3/8" dowel in the small pocket at the top which is 8" long. There's a small hole in each end of the dowel with a cord running through it to hang the fish extender up by the fish. The pockets are very siimplly made, using bindinng tape instead of hems all around. The fabric is stiffened with some kind of an iron-on thin batting, but I think heavy iron on interfacing would do the trick.
